Kishtwar, Jan 20: Alleging Kishtwar Development Authority (KDA) for its failure to perform, the Congress leader and former District President Youth Congress Kishtwar Sheikh Nasir Hussain Advocate today said that the KDA has utterly failed to explore "Tourism potential of Kishtwar. In a statement issued to press, Congress leader has said that KDA was created with the objective to explore and develop the tourism potential of the area but the authority has utterly failed to explore the tourism potential of the district. "There is lot of scope of adventure and pilgrimage tourism but the KDA has totally failed to explore the same and there is no ground development of the same, he said, adding, "not a single festival or any adventure camp has been organized by KDA till date. He also criticized the Kishtwar Development Authority (KDA) for its failure to boost the tourism and creation of the amenities in the area for the tourists. Sheikh Nasir alleged that due to lack of vision, they have failed to boost the tourism of the area including picturesque Sinthon, Warwan, and other places are yet are neglected at tourism map. He appealed to Minister for Tourism Ghulam Ahmad Mir to intervene into the matter. |
